    France wildfire forces 250,000 to evacuate as blaze nears Bordeaux

    More than a quarter-million people have been driven from their homes in southwest France as a massive wildfire barrels toward the famed wine capital of Bordeaux, with officials warning the fast-moving inferno has become so fierce it’s creating its own winds and behaving erratically.

    French authorities ordered another 55,000 people to evacuate overnight Sunday from communities south of Bordeaux, bringing the total number of evacuees in the region to about 250,000. Gusty winds, dry conditions and repeated heat waves have fueled a fire that has burned out of control since midweek.

    Interior Minister Laurent Nunez said firefighters faced a “difficult” night and warned Sunday that “the situation remains very unfavorable.”

    “The fire again became extremely virulent again and unpredictable, generating its own winds and advancing erratically toward the Bordeaux metropolitan area,” Nunez posted on X, adding that the blaze “became calmer by the end of the night.”

    The fire has now burned an estimated 42,000 hectares, or about 162 square miles — roughly four times the size of Paris — in the Gironde region. Bordeaux Mayor Thomas Cazenave said the flames came within about 9 miles of the city, prompting officials to partially close a major highway into and out of the region.

    More than 2,500 firefighters, backed by 18 planes and helicopters, are working to slow the fire’s advance. France has also deployed 1,500 soldiers to help clear vegetation and build firebreaks, while several European countries have sent aircraft and firefighting crews to assist.

    Nunez said 450 volunteers have also pitched in to help.

    “We ⁠came to lend a hand because if it were our region, we’d want others to do the ​same,” 65-year-old farmer Pascal Roudier told Reuters. “And given the scale of the disaster, we ​think our⁠ efforts are very welcome too.”

    The Bordeaux-area fire is one of several major wildfires burning across France. A separate blaze in the neighboring Landes region has forced another 36,000 people to evacuate, while nearly 3,000 others have left their homes in southern France’s Var region along the Mediterranean coast.

    Neighboring Spain is facing its own wildfire emergency.

    Authorities there have evacuated about 116,000 people in recent days as fires burned across the Valencia region and west of Madrid. A fast-moving fire in a Valencia suburb killed one man Saturday, marking Spain’s first wildfire death in the latest wave of fires.

    Earlier this month, 13 people were killed in southern Spain in the country’s deadliest wildfire in recent memory.
